Blueskin® Butyl is a versatile, self-adhering window and door flashing membrane that provides a strong, tear-resistant, self-sealing barrier to protect from moisture intrusion. To keep projects on schedule – even during winter months – it can be installed in temperatures as low as 25° F.
When used as part of the Henry® 1-2-3 Moisture Control System™, Blueskin Butyl is backed by an industry-leading 15-year warranty. Repairs are covered for both materials and labor with a single point of contact.
